Librarian Salary in Buffalo, NY — 2026

The median Librarian salary in Buffalo, NY is $57,200 per year ($4,767/month, $28/hr). This reflects the local cost of living index of 88, which is 12% below the national average.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average Librarian salary in Buffalo, NY?
The median Librarian salary in Buffalo, NY is $57,200 per year as of 2026. This is adjusted for the local cost of living index of 88. Entry-level Librarians earn around $36,960, while senior-level professionals can earn $66,880 or more.
How much does a Librarian take home in Buffalo after taxes?
A Librarian earning the median salary of $57,200 in Buffalo, NY takes home approximately $44,378 per year ($3,698/month) after federal, state, and local taxes. The effective tax rate is 22.4%.
Is Buffalo a good city for Librarians?
Buffalo, NY has a cost of living index of 88 (below national average). Librarians here earn above the city median. The local unemployment rate is 4.5% and top industries include Healthcare, Education, Finance.
What skills are needed for a Librarian in Buffalo?
Key skills for Librarians include Information Retrieval, Cataloging, Digital Resources, Reference Services, Programming. Typical education requirement is Master's Degree (MLIS). Valuable certifications include State Certification, ALA Accredited MLIS.
How does Librarian salary in Buffalo compare to the national average?
The national median Librarian salary is $65,000. In Buffalo, the adjusted salary is $57,200, which is 12.0% lower than the national average, reflecting the local cost of living.
